해시 자료구조

Soorim Yoon·2022년 9월 9일
0
post-custom-banner

해시

해시(hash)는 데이터를 효율적으로 관리하기 위해 임의의 길이의 데이터를 고정된 길이의 데이터로 매핑하는 자료구조이다.
매핑 전 원래의 데이터 값을 key(키), 매핑 후 데이터의 값을 hash value(해시 값), 매핑하는 과정을 hashing(해싱)이라고 한다.

코딩테스트에서 해시를 활용하는 문제들은 파이썬의 딕셔너리를 사용해서 구현하는 문제이다.
해당 문제들은 해시를 사용하지 않고 리스트를 활용하는 등의 방법으로 문제를 풀면 시간 초과 에러가 발생한다. 효율성 검사를 통과할 수 없다.

profile
👩🏻‍💻 AI를 좋아하는 IT학부생

0개의 댓글